Richard D. Dills, 72, of Goshen, died Saturday morning, June 26, 2010, at The Maples at Waterford Crossing. He was born in Elkhart County on November 8, 1937, to the late Clare Dills and Iris (Hershberger) Dills of Goshen. He married Rosemary Ecker on April 25, 1964 in Goshen. She survives. Also surviving are a son, Rick (Connie) Dills of Goshen; three grandchildren; one great-grandchild; seven sisters, Carol Moles of Claremot, North Carolina, Marvel Joy Moles, Bonnie (Robert) Null and Betty (Don) Dirck, all of Goshen, Ann (Robert) Falconi of Frederick, Maryland, Kitty Fink of Nappanee, Mary (Jonas) Miller of Elkhart; and three brothers, William (Frances) Dills, John Dills and Mike Dills, all of Goshen. He was preceded in death by a daughter, Jeannie E. Dills and a sister, Janet Dills. Mr. Dills worked as a press operator at Goshen Rubber for 35 years. He enjoyed going to auctions and sold produce in his front yard for several years. Friends may call 2 to 4 and 6 to 8 p.m., Monday, June 28, at Yoder-Culp Funeral Home, were a 10:00 a.m., Tuesday, June 29, 2010, funeral will be conducted. Pastor Mel Shetler of Maple City Chapel will officiate. Burial will follow in West Goshen Cemetery, Goshen. Memorial contributions may be made to the American Heart Association.
